Should i wait to buy applecare for my macbook pro until the one year warranty is almost up?

Would i benefit from waiting till the one year warranty  is almost up.  Because then i would maximize the time in which it is under warranty right??

If you get AppleCare before 90 days is up you also continue free phone tech support from Apple - so by getting it as early as possible you increase the time you can get free phone support. If you go past 90 days you won't be eligible for free phone support until you get AppleCare, but still get hardware warranty for the full one year from date of purchase.

  • HT4528 is a single crack on the front screen of an iphone 5 for verizon  covered under the one year warranty

    is a single crack on the front screen of an iphone 5 for verizon  covered under the one year warranty at no cost

    Not unless the crack is determined to be caused by a manufacturing error.
    Accidental damage is not covered under the standard one year warranty, which is a limited manufacturing warranty, not insurance.

  • I just downloaded Mountain Lion for my MacBook Pro from the App Store.  Can I also download it for my iMac without paying the $19.99 fee again?

    I just downloaded Mountain Lion for my MacBook Pro from the App Store.  I was curious if it is possible to downloand Mountain Lion to my iMac without paying the $19.99 fee again?  Not trying to be a cheapskate, just curious if App Store purchases are universal like iTunes Apps.

    You can re download Mountain Lion for free on all your authorized Macs using the same Apple ID used for the original purchase.
    How to re download apps from the Mac App Store:
    Open the App Store. From the menu bar click Store > Sign In
    Click Purchases from the top of the App Store window.
    Select  Mountain Lion.
    Then right or control click where you see Installed then click Install.
